In my case, I started driver programming with "Programming the Microsoft Windows Driver Model" by Walter Oney. Windows DDK/WDK documents are also helpful.

The latest framework for writing device drivers for Windows is the Windows Driver Foundation (WDF).
Microsoft recommends you use WDF. It is a wrapper around the Windows Driver Model (WDM) and eases driver development drastically. Many difficult tasks like power management and plug and play which are mandatory for all drivers are taken care of by the framework unless you want to override the default behavior. It is what MFC is to Win32.

You need to get this book - Developing Drivers with the Windows® Driver Foundation[^]
